    What to Do on Uganda Bush Memories? Uganda Safari Attractions

    Gorilla Trekking

    Coming face to face with mountain gorillas in the dense forests of Bwindi Impenetrable National Park or Mgahinga Gorilla National Park is an awe-inspiring experience. Watching these gentle giants in their natural habitat, observing their behavior, and realizing their close connection to humans is an incredible memory that will stay with you forever.

    Chimpanzee Tracking

    Uganda is also renowned for its chimpanzee tracking experiences. Trekking through the lush forests of Kibale Forest National Park, Budongo Forest, or Kyambura Gorge to encounter our closest relatives in the wild is an exhilarating and memorable adventure.

    Wildlife Encounters

    Uganda is home to a diverse range of wildlife. From the savannahs of Queen Elizabeth National Park, Murchison Falls National Park, and Kidepo Valley National Park to the wetlands of Kazinga Channel and the Nile River, you can witness elephants, lions, leopards, buffaloes, giraffes, hippos, crocodiles, and numerous bird species. The sight of these majestic creatures in their natural habitat is a thrilling experience.

    Bird watching

    Uganda is a paradise for bird enthusiasts, with over 1,000 bird species recorded. The vibrant colors and unique calls of the African Grey Parrot, Shoebill Stork, African Fish Eagle, and numerous other species make bird watching a memorable experience.

    Murchison Falls National Park

    Situated along the Nile River, this park is known for its powerful waterfall and diverse wildlife. Take a boat safari on the Nile to observe hippos, crocodiles, and other animals, and enjoy game drives to see elephants, giraffes, lions, and more.

    Queen Elizabeth National Park

    Located in western Uganda, this park offers a diverse range of wildlife, including elephants, lions, leopards, buffaloes, hippos, and numerous bird species. The boat cruises along the Kazinga Channel provide an opportunity to see wildlife up close.

    Best Time for Bush Memories Travel in Uganda

    The best time for bush memories travel in Uganda depends on various factors, including weather, wildlife activity, and personal preferences. Here’s a breakdown of the different seasons and what they offer:

    Dry Season (December to February, June to August)

    The dry season in Uganda is generally considered the best time for bush travel. The weather is typically warm and dry, making it easier to navigate through the parks and spot wildlife. The vegetation is less dense during this time, improving visibility. Additionally, gorilla trekking tends to be more comfortable as the trails are less muddy. This period is considered the peak tourist season, so expect higher rates and more crowds.

    Wet Season (March to May, September to November)

    The wet season in Uganda brings lush green landscapes and fewer crowds. While rainfall can occur during the day, wildlife sightings can still be rewarding. The wet season is an excellent time for bird watching as many migratory bird species visit Uganda during this time. It’s worth noting that some dirt roads may become challenging to navigate, and gorilla trekking trails can be muddy and more strenuous.

    Shoulder Seasons

    The months of November and March are transitional periods between the dry and wet seasons. These shoulder seasons can offer a balance between lower visitor numbers and reasonably good weather conditions, although rainfall is still possible. Prices may be more affordable during these times, and wildlife sightings can still be impressive.

    It’s important to keep in mind that weather patterns can vary, and climate change may impact traditional weather patterns. Therefore, it’s advisable to check the latest weather forecasts and consult with local experts or tour operators for the most up-to-date information.

    Lastly, specific activities like gorilla and chimpanzee trekking can be done year-round. However, obtaining permits for these experiences is highly competitive, so it’s recommended to book well in advance, regardless of the time of year you plan to visit.
